What You’ll Do

  • Process donated goods using Goodwill’s One Touch System standards
  • Sort items into saleable goods, e-commerce, salvage, or waste categories
  • Price wares and softlines according to organizational guidelines
  • Meet production and quality standards for processed items
  • Preserve the value and quality of donated goods
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work area
  • Work respectfully with team members and program participants
  • Complete required training and follow all safety procedures


Production Expectations

  • Wares: 63 items per hour
  • Softlines: 50 items per hour
  • Bin Processing: 1 rack every 1.5 hours
  • Maintain quality standards with less than 10% pull rate during audits

Physical Requirements & Work Environment

  • Standing for extended periods with frequent bending and twisting
  • Lift and move items up to
    50 lbs regularly
  • Production/plant environment with exposure to dust and lint
  • Occasional local travel for training
